The wedding celebration at Sunstone Villa in Santa Ynez unfolded as a thoughtfully layered, two-day experience that honored culture, family, and community with intention. The first day began quietly and meaningfully with a traditional Paebaek ceremony, held at the villa and reserved for immediate family.
Rooted in Korean heritage, the Paebaek centered on reverence and blessing—parents seated before the couple as tea was served, chestnuts and dates tossed to symbolize fertility and prosperity, and moments of laughter woven into rituals like the playful “who wears the pants” and displays of strength. The intimacy of this ceremony allowed space for emotion and reflection, setting a grounding tone before the couple transitioned into a private family dinner nearby.
